本篇教程分為三個部分:
- 【全教程】qt連接mysql——從qt編譯mysql驅動到qt連接mysql資料庫(一、編譯連接前準備)
- 【全教程】qt連接mysql——從qt編譯mysql驅動到qt連接mysql資料庫(二、編譯連接)
- 【全教程】qt連接mysql——從qt編譯mysql驅動到qt連接mysql資料庫(三、問題整理)
1. QSqlDatabase: QMYSQL driver not loaded
這個表示是沒有加載QMSQL驅動,可能原因有兩種
(1)第一種:可用驅動中有QMYSQL這個驅動,但是不能加載,去查看第二部分的第二編譯連接的第九步

(2)第二種:可用驅動中沒有MYSQL驅動,并且不能加載,這個需要完整參考本教程可以解決,從第一部分看,

2.error: Library 'mysql' is not defined.
這個解決辦法可以查看第二部分的編譯連接程序整個程序,
3.error: mysql.h: No such file or directory#include <mysql.h>
這個解決辦法可以查看第二部分的編譯連接程序的第四步以后,
4. error: undefined reference to `mysql_stmt_num_rows'
這個解決辦法可以查看第二部分的編譯連接程序的第五步第一部分,

5.Cannot read F:/qtsqldrivers-config.pri: No such file or directory
這個解決辦法可以查看第二部分的編譯連接程序的第五步第二部分,
轉載參考分享此篇文章請注明出處!
轉載請註明出處,本文鏈接:https://www.uj5u.com/qita/257363.html
標籤:其他
上一篇:643.子陣列最大平均數 I
